Okay so finally gonna jump in...About my third grow as first 2 have been staggered. Trying 4 HBSS from Mitch and the guys at Mephisto Genetics. The plants are in 5 gallon Smart pots. Sitting under two 700W Mars 2 LEDs. I will be using the Fox Farm lineup of nutrients, as I bought their dirty dozen box, so any issues/concerns over nutes would be helpful...I plan on pretty much sticking to their printed schedule, starting slowly of course. The sprouts are in a mix of FF Happy Frog, Ocean Forest, Perlite, and Dolomitic Lime. PH in soil is around 6.3-6.4. Every liquid added is also PHed to about 6.4. Also using GH CalMag+. Lighting schedule is 20/4. Tent temps are around 70 to 83 degrees Fahrenheit. RH is always around 40%. Tent is 4'x4' with the purple trim, I don't remember the brand. Carbon filter is a Phresh 6x16 with a 400cfm exhaust fan. Small oscillating fan in the tent for a slight breeze. Date stamp on pictures will be correct...Day 1 is 9/15/2015. On my lighter feedsI use 1 teaspoon per gallon, usually around week 4 I'm feeding heavier and I use 2 teaspoons per gallon. Subbed up for this and good luck.
 
Thanks Marga for the help...Everyone's plants look so nice, worried about messing something up. Any idea of optimum light height in a 4x4 tent with 640 watts?
I'm still a little new with leds and getting myself dialed in. My young seedlings like yours I have about 32 inches from my light. I move them closer little by little as they get a little older and I see there is no problems. Those HBSS will take off on you around day 25 to day 40 and mine is 40 inches now and probably 10 inches from the light, maybe 8, I had no more room to move it and the light wasn't hurting it. Some of the guys like there lights a good distance for taller plants. These HBSS seem to have no problem getting tall. I'm always moving them up and down as they progress.
